
The Law Technology Services Department (LTS) provides assistance to students, faculty and staff who are using computers and audiovisual equipment. We maintain the Law School’s desktop and laptop computers, printers, and servers. We also provide students with assistance in configuring and maintaining their laptop computers.
Our classrooms all have permanently installed audiovisual equipment which is maintained by LTS staff. Portable audiovisual equipment is available as needed for all other rooms and classrooms.

Recommended Computer Specifications for Law Students
PC:
1.2 GHz
P IV or equivalent AMD (Dual Core recommended)
2 GB (4 GB or more highly recommended)
100 GB hard drive
Windows 7, Windows Vista, or Windows XP, all with latest service pack applied
For laptops, wireless B network capability (Wireless G network capability highly recommended)
10/100 Ethernet connection
Ethernet cable
CD/DVD drive (DVD-RW highly recommended)
Power cord / power supply
2 GB USB flash drive (optional) (4 GB recommended)
Web camera (optional)
Mac:
1.2 GHz (1.6 GHz Intel Dual Core processor recommended)
2 GB (4 GB or more highly recommended)
100 GB hard drive
MAC OS 10.5 or later (You are required to have 10.5 or newer to use ExamSoft)
For laptops, Airport card (WiFi)
10/100 Ethernet
Ethernet cable
CD/DVD drive (DVD-RW highly recommended)
Power cord
2 GB USB flash drive (optional) (4 GB recommended)
iSight camera (optional)
Computer Labs
Three computer labs are available for the exclusive use by the School of Law: two labs are located in the Gold Star Memorial Building (law library), rooms 186 and 197, and one lb is located in the Sarkeys Law Center. Only OCU law students and law faculty may use the computer labs. The labs open when the law buildings open; however, the labs close approximately fifteen minutes before the law buildings close. Feel free to ask one of our lab monitors for help the first time you log on. A variety of word and data processing programs as well as legal educational resources are loaded on the computers for student use.
Lab #1 is our largest lab and is located at the far northwest corner of the first floor of the Gold Star Memorial Building (Law Library). This is also where you will find the Lab Monitors and IT Specialist, should you have any questions.
Lab #2 is our training lab and is located at the far north end of the first floor of the Gold Star Law Memorial Building (Law Library). This is most likely where you will receive your Lexis Nexis and Westlaw training.
Lab #3 is adjacent to the student lounge in the Sarkeys Law Center.
